LITTLE ROCK -Â Presidential hopeful Mike Huckabee says he has no plans to try for a U-S Senate seat, if his bid for the Republican nomination falls short. Huckabee says he knows rumors persist that he may drop out of the presidential race to challenge current Democratic Senator Mark Pryor.
      Huckabee said, quote, ”I don’t see it happening.” The former governor has trailed in polls and in fundraising compared with better-known candidates like former New York Mayor Rudy Giuliani, Arizona Senator John McCain and former Massachusetts Governor Mitt Romney.
